US Sanctions Wallets Tied to Iran, Freezing $344 Million in Cryptocurrency
The U.S. Treasury Department is sanctioning multiple wallets tied to Iran, thereby freezing $344 million in cryptocurrency,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ent said in a statement on X. — (Reporting by Ismail Shakil; Editing by Katharine Jackson)
